Materials Data on SeI2 by Materials Project
Abstract
SeI2 crystallizes in the tetragonal P4_2/mnm space group. The structure is one-dimensional and consists of two SeI2 ribbons oriented in the (0, 0, 1) direction. Se is bonded in a square co-planar geometry to four equivalent I atoms. All Se–I bond lengths are 2.82 Å. I is bonded in an L-shaped geometry to two equivalent Se atoms.
